While treadmills may seem simple, various types cater to different needs and preferences. Here are the main classifications:
Manual Treadmills: These require no power and are moved by the user's effort. They typically use up less area and are quieter however can provide a steeper learning curve for newbies.
Electric or Motorized Treadmills: The most typical type, they feature automated programs for speed and slope. They are usually more flexible but need electricity to operate.
Folding Treadmills: Designed for those with restricted space, folding treadmills can be collapsed and stored away when not in use, making them ideal for studio apartments.
Slope Treadmills: These machines use the ability to raise the slope, simulating hill runs for a more effective workout.
Industrial Treadmills: Built for heavy use, these machines are normally found in health clubs and health clubs and come with a series of features and toughness.

A1: It is usually advised to use a treadmill at least 3 times per week for 30-60 minutes to see significant outcomes.
Q2: Can I slim down using a treadmill?
A2: Yes, with a combination of routine exercise, a well balanced diet plan, and portion control, utilizing a treadmill can contribute significantly to weight loss.
Q3: Do I need to warm-up before using the treadmill?
A3: Yes, heating up is necessary to prepare your body, decrease the risk of injury, and enhance exercise performance.
Q4: Is working on a treadmill as efficient as running outdoors?
A4: Both have benefits, but a treadmill permits for regulated environments, preventing weather-related disturbances, and may have less effect on the joints.
Q5: Can a treadmill aid with muscle structure?
A5: While primarily a cardiovascular tool, adjusting inclines can assist engage and strengthen particular leg muscles.
